Are there any specific vocal exercises that can help?
Yes! Vocal exercises can significantly enhance the quality of your voice. Try humming or making high-pitched sounds, like sirens, to warm up your vocal cords. Additionally, practicing scales and intervals can help you develop control over your pitch and increase your vocal range.
Does posture play a role in voice projection?
Absolutely! Proper posture helps optimize the airflow and resonance in your body, resulting in improved voice projection. Stand tall with your chest lifted, shoulders back, and pelvis aligned. This posture will allow you to access your full vocal potential and produce a more commanding voice.
Can speaking too quietly affect the perception of my voice?
Speaking too quietly can make it difficult for others to hear you, diminishing the impact of your message. To project your voice effectively, imagine you are speaking to the person furthest away from you in the room. By adjusting your volume and speaking with more clarity, you can immediately create a stronger presence.

Are there any tips for speaking at a higher pitch without straining my voice?It’s important to find a balance between raising your pitch and straining your vocal cords. Start by gradually increasing your pitch during conversations or presentations, allowing your voice to adjust naturally over time. Avoid forcing your voice into a high pitch, as this can lead to vocal fatigue or damage.
